Boko Haram will be child’s play’ – Obasanjo cautions against uncontrolled population

Former President Olusegun Obasanjo says if Nigeria’s population growth is not tackled, it could cause serious consequences.

Obasanjo made this statement on Tuesday at the inauguration of the Bakhita ICT Centre at the Catholic Secretariat in Sokoto.

He emphasized the importance of education and knowledge, describing them as tools for national development.

“By the year 2050, people like the Sultan will be here. I am not praying to be here 25 years from now.

“We will have the problem of 400 million Nigerians that have to be provided with food, work that have to be satisfied. If we fail to prepare for that, Boko Haram of today will be a child’s play. We have to take care of it now,” he said.

The ex-Nigerian leader equally called on the citizens to embrace the nation’s unity in diversity and resist external narratives that misrepresent the country.
